The merchandise references a printed work detailing the experiences of the 6888th Central Postal Listing Battalion. This battalion, composed completely of African-American ladies, served throughout World Warfare II, taking part in an important function in sorting and distributing mail to American troops stationed in Europe. An instance could be a non-fiction account or historic novel centered on this particular group.

Its significance stems from highlighting a traditionally marginalized group’s contributions to the conflict effort. It brings to mild the challenges confronted by these ladies, each as troopers and as African Individuals in a segregated army. The narrative usually emphasizes their willpower, resilience, and important function in sustaining morale among the many troops by guaranteeing they acquired correspondence from residence. This historic context contributes to a broader understanding of the varied experiences inside World Warfare II.

Incessantly Requested Questions Concerning Narratives In regards to the 6888th Central Postal Listing Battalion

The next addresses widespread questions concerning the narratives documenting the service and significance of the 6888th Central Postal Listing Battalion.

Query 1: What particular historic interval does accounts pertaining to the 6888th Central Postal Listing Battalion primarily cowl?

The narratives primarily cowl the World Warfare II period, particularly specializing in the years 1945-1946 when the battalion was deployed to Europe to handle the mail backlog.

Query 2: What distinguishes narratives concerning the 6888th from different accounts of World Warfare II?

The narratives distinguish themselves by specializing in the distinctive experiences of African-American ladies serving in a segregated army unit throughout World Warfare II, highlighting their contributions to postal operations and troop morale.

Query 3: What main challenges are highlighted in narratives discussing the 6888th?

Major challenges highlighted embody racial discrimination, segregation throughout the army, logistical obstacles in clearing the mail backlog, and the battle for recognition of their service.

Query 4: What influence did the 6888th have on troop morale, as portrayed in these narratives?

The narratives emphasize the optimistic influence on troop morale ensuing from the environment friendly processing and supply of mail, which fostered a way of connection to residence and diminished emotions of isolation amongst troopers.

Query 5: What efforts have been made to make sure correct historic illustration within the narratives concerning the 6888th?

Efforts to make sure accuracy embody counting on main supply supplies, resembling letters, diaries, and official army information, in addition to conducting interviews with surviving members of the battalion and their households.

Query 6: What’s the significance of continued curiosity within the narratives surrounding the 6888th?

Continued curiosity is critical as a result of it promotes a extra inclusive understanding of World Warfare II historical past, acknowledges the contributions of marginalized teams, and challenges historic narratives which have historically neglected the experiences of African-American ladies.
